Judge of the Municipal Court in Sarajevo Pavle Crnogorac issued yesterday (at the request of Ranko Debevec, President of the Court of Bosnia and Herzegovina) a decision (65 0 P 887562 21 Mo of 1 February 2021), prohibiting “Avaz-roto press” from publishing information from his private life.

No one should be untouchable

This decision, apart from being a blow to the most widely read media in Bosnia and Herzegovina and the introduction of the darkest form of censorship in journalists' reporting on public figures and public officials, was imposed contrary to the provisions of the FB&H Law on Civil Procedure and the FB&H Law on Protection from Defamation, which the judge completely ignored.

The right to freedom of expression is guaranteed by the Constitution of Bosnia and Herzegovina, the Constitution of FB&H, as well as the European Convention for the Protection of Human Rights and Fundamental Freedoms, and represents one of the essential foundations of a democratic society, especially in matters of political and public interest.

Ranko Debevec is a judge of the Court of B&H and the President of the Court of B&H, he holds the most important position in the judiciary in the country and as such cannot and must not be untouchable and exempt from criticism from journalists.

The editorial board of “Dnevni Avaz” believe that Debevec must not be exempted from legal and moral responsibility for his actions and therefore cannot be distinguished from holders of office in the legislative or executive branch.

He, as the President of the Court of B&H, must not be favored by any judge in making decisions on his private lawsuits, because this directly undermines the trust of citizens in the judiciary.

The decision of the municipal judge Crnogorac does not contain any explanation for what urgent reasons it was enacted.

Article 10, paragraph 3 of the FB&H Law on Protection against Defamation, which the judge does not mention at all, stipulates that a temporary court measure prohibiting the disclosure or further disclosure of false facts may be ordered only if the damaged side can make it probable that that expression caused damage to his reputation and that the damaged side will suffer irreparable damage as a result of the transmission of that expression.

The judge does not explain in a single word how Ranko Debevec, with the greatest certainty, proved that untruths were published about him and that he suffers damage.

And how the Court within two days (the lawsuit dates from January 28th, 2021. - Thursday, the decision from February 1st, 2021. - Monday) found that "Dnevni avaz" published untruths, taking into consideration the fact that no one from "Avaz" was questioned.

Without allowing Dnevni Avaz's journalists and lawyers to comment on Ranko Debevec's allegations, judge Pavle Crnogorac himself decided in an expressly short period of time that „Dnevni Avaz“ had published untruths and that Debevec had proved this with the greatest certainty only by filing a lawsuit which contains the published texts.

Journalists of "Dnevni avaz", as legalists, will respect the decision of the Court, although we did not write about the "love and private life" of the President of the Court of B&H Ranko Debevac, but about the abuse of office of the President of the Court for private purposes.

This, of course, does not mean that we will not continue to write about all the topics we have written about in our texts, and they concern possible acts of corruption and abuse of office of the President of the Court of B&H.

We remind you that Debevec is obliged to explain to the public and the competent state bodies why he has a dual identity, ie one name - Ranko Debevec, which he uses in B&H, and another name - Ranko Debevec Kaveson, which he uses in Spain.

Also, the President of the Court of B&H should explain the possession of dual citizenship, B&H and Spain, and why when applying for the position of judge and later the President of the Court of B&H did not report that he has dual citizenship.

Debevec, and we also wrote about that, did not report in his property card that he owned real estate in Spain and Croatia, and he was obliged by law to do so.
